It is a pretty long interview. I was asked multiple questions, including situational question. After that, there was a roleplay, where I act as an employee to the customer. They ended up accepting me and giving me the job offer on site. They got me at starting pay rate but promised a better career yearly.
Interior Designer/Sales applicants have rated the interview process at Living Spaces with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 58.5%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
